The ballistic method of developing flexibility is the safest form of stretching. please select the best answer from the choices

provided. t f
Biology
2 answers:
Veseljchak [2.6K]3 years ago
6 0

Answer;

The above statement is false.

The ballistic method of developing flexibility is not the safest form of stretching.

Explanation;

-Ballistic stretching uses the momentum of a moving body or a limb in an attempt to force it beyond its normal range of motion. It involves stretching by bouncing into (or out of) a stretched position, using the stretched muscles as a spring which pulls you out of the stretched position. An example is the ballistic method of touching your toes would be to bounce and move toward your feet.
